In the years between the late 1950s right through to the mid eighties, Minolta was arguably the most innovative camera manufacturer: the earliest Japanese producer to introduce a bayonet lens mount as opposed to a screw mount; the very first manufacturer to introduce Through The Lens (TTL) metering using full aperture; and also the earliest maker to bring in multimode metering. Additionally , they launched the first commercially successful autofocus SLR collection with the Maxxum models. Minolta cameras attracted experienced hobbyist photography addicts with their lower prices and top quality optics.
In 1972, Minolta drew up a formal collaboration deal with Leitz. Leitz were seeking proficiency in camera body electronics, and Minolta believed they could very well learn through Leitz's undoubted optical skills. Tangible upshot of this alliance had been the Minolta and Leica CL models, a cost-effective rangefinder camera to complement the Leica M range. The Leica CL had been assembled by Minolta to Leica specs. Other benefits had been the Leica R3, which had been in fact the Minolta XE-1 having a Leica lens mount, viewfinder, together with spot metering system.
